Based in San Mateo, California, Super Evil Megacorp created a stir last year with the showing of their action-filled MOBA, Vainglory. Their game was chosen to show-off the high-quality graphics that the latest Apple devices could achieve. Fast-forward a few months later, and we now learn that Vainglory will be coming to Android devices too.

[GDC 2015] Nvidia announces the Shield Android TV console. It’s a singular device for in-home entertainment and gaming
Nvidia held their big press event at GDC 2015 and the company had been hinting at a big announcement, stating it was five years in the making. Everyone had their guesses as to what this would be, with a lot of people pointing to VR as being the announcement. We actually guessed it would be a console in a previous article. When the event began, the CEO of Nvidia Jen-Hsun Huang, came out and told everyone right away that he had three things to announce: a new revolutionary TV, a new super computer, and a new console. Turns out, it wasn’t three devices, it was just one.
